Product Description MODEL- 15265 VENDOR- ELECTRONIC ARTS FEATURES- Battlefield 2142 PC Earth, 2142. As a new ice age depletes the planet s resources, two massive multinational coalitions wage a brutal war for the only cause that matters-survival. Armed with a devastating arsenal of futuristic weaponry and gear, including active camouflage, EMP grenades, and sentry guns, plus Battle Walkers and vast airborne bases called Titans, you must coordinate the efforts of your teammates to win the war for Earth s last fragile pieces of livable land. With extensive improvements to the groundbreaking Battlefield 2- ranking and upgrade system and the new Titan gameplay mode, Battlefield 2142 brings the franchise s award-winning onlinewarfare into a harsh and desperate future. * A Whole New Battlefield-The award-winning franchise blasts into the distant future. With Earth s icecaps threatening to cover the globe, civilizations must push toward the equator in an all-out war for every resource and every inch of land. * Titans Rule the Skies-These massive airborne carriers/warships serve as home bases. Great successor and reason to "upgrade" June 26, 2007 R. Griewel (Germany) 9 out of 10 found this review helpful
I've been a regular player (not extensive, maybe 5 hours/week) of Battlefield 2. I enjoyed the game a lot but with very dominant air superiority,bad auto balancing and the recent announcement of EA not to release any patches anymore I lost my interested.
Looking at Battlefield 2142 I thought, I give it a try and I have to say I am not dissapointed, on the contrary! The game hast all the fun from the original Battlefield series PLUS cool additions.
Here are the things I presonally think EA has improved:
- The Weapon upgrade mode is better, you can upgrade additional items more often andnot only new wapons
- the map display looks better
- the vehicles and terrain looks better
- the titan mode, where you have to hold as many "flags" as possible to destroy the enemies base but also can attack that base directly is a lot of fun
- it seems that people play more as teams online - even without knowing each other...
All in all - well done EA. Too bad that you sell the addon Northern Strike instead of giving it out for free as a patch...

Excellent FPS!! August 9, 2007 Garry Adams (Cedar City, UT) 3 out of 4 found this review helpful
What can I say... Battlefield, next generation. It's awesome. (If your machine can handle it.) I actually upgraded my entire computer, mostly so I could play BF2142. My old Athlon XP 3200+ / Radeon 9600 128mb card / 1GB DDR 400 could play it, but there was some bad lag, even on lowest settings. (Now I'm running Athlon X2 5600+ Radeon 2900XT 2X1GB DDR-II 800, etc...) The tactical options are great. Weapons rock, and vehicles are totally cool. The only downside is that you have to play online to earn upgrades. (not that playing online is a downside, online multiplay is SO much better than AI bots... but it would be nice to be able to earn upgrades in single player mode offline.) The original release was buggy, but with patches, this game runs flawlessly, even on Vista Ultimate. Two words, BUY IT!!!.
